Abstract

Aiming at the multi-star mission planning problem for deep space exploration missions, considering the constraints of satellite on target time window, satellite attitude maneuver and working energy consumption, a multi-star mission planning problem model for deep space exploration mission is established. In the process of large-scale satellite mission planning, the existing coding length is too long. A genetic algorithm based on real coding is proposed to solve the multi-star mission planning problem for deep space exploration. The algorithm adopts a real-number coding method with the target as the chromosome. Compared with the traditional 01 coding method with the time window as the chromosome, the chromosome length is shortened, which can effectively improve the efficiency of the algorithm. Through the numerical example analysis, the correctness, rationality and effectiveness of the genetic algorithm based on real number coding for solving multi-star task planning problems are verified. Compared with the genetic algorithm based on traditional 01 coding method, the results show that the genetic algorithm based on real coding has obvious advantages in optimization ability and calculation speed. This provides a new idea and method for solving multi-star mission planning problems for deep space exploration missions.
